What they call their work
6 Degrees of FM
Host Nick Pardo connects songs through shared performers, writers, or samples, creating a musical journey across genres and eras.
A.I. in the Catskills
Breck Baldwin and AI co-host Eliza explore practical applications of artificial intelligence for local businesses, nonprofits, and individuals.
Catskills Folk
Folklorist Ginny Scheer presents traditional music, folklore, and history of the Catskills region, including fiddling and square dance calls.
Democracy Now!
Independent news program hosted by Amy Goodman, providing award-winning, fact-based reporting on national and global issues with a focus on justice and democracy.
HealthCetera in the Catskills
Diana Mason, PhD, RN, discusses local, state, and national health and social issues affecting the Catskills communities.
Unidos por las Montanas
Spanish-language program hosted by Raul Silva Rosas that addresses social issues and features music and guests relevant to the local Hispanic community.

Community and Public Broadcasting Services 4 activities
- Broadcast Democracy Now! for the Catskills audienceBroadcasts the independent news program Democracy Now! every weekday from noon to 1:00 PM, providing award-winning, fact-based reporting on global justice and democratic issues to local communities.
- Operate a non-commercial educational FM radio stationOwns and operates a non-commercial educational FM radio station serving the rural Catskill Mountains region of upstate New York, broadcasting diverse local and national programming including news, music, and community-focused content.
- Produce and broadcast local and diverse radio programmingProduces live, local radio programs covering a range of topics including agriculture, forest resources, health and social issues, poetry, Catskills traditions, and music that connects songs through shared performers, writers, or samples across genres and eras.
- Provide overnight classical music programmingBroadcasts classical music programming overnight from midnight to 8:00 AM daily, with extended hours to 9:00 AM or 10:00 AM on select days.

relationships · 4
Who they work with
- Catskill Forest Association Partner — Collaborates on programming about local forest resources, with Ryan Trapani from the organization hosting segments.
- Delaware County Chamber of Commerce Partner — Collaborates with underwriters who receive membership in the Delaware County Chamber of Commerce as part of their underwriting benefits.
- Democracy Now! Partner — WIOX broadcasts the nationally syndicated program Democracy Now! with Amy Goodman.
- Radio Catskill Partner — Merger announced between WIOX Community Radio and Radio Catskill to strengthen public radio sustainability.
